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Granada to Cusco is to train and fly which costs $440 - $1,200 and takes 21h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Granada to Cusco is to fly which takes 19h 15m and costs $500 - $1,500.
The distance between Granada and Cusco is 9085 km.
It takes approximately 19h 15m to get from Granada to Cusco, including transfers.
Cusco is 7h behind Granada. It is currently 11:19 PM in Granada and 4:19 PM in Cusco.
